M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. 2015.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.
Find out more about the new book MOOCs and Open Education
MOOCs and Open Education is a
edited collection
that
discusses
topics
having to do with open
educational resources
(OERs) and
massive open online courses (MOOCs).
New
improvements in
distance learning technology are making it possible for
students
in all parts of the world
to take online courses.
These MOOCs are
free
for students but do not
always
lead to formal accreditation.
